Output 21a7fb39595d5d6f5988c4b357988b74f55589f558c7bdb46ca740ea7d68a155:0

value
3426212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ab4b492fe31033b03d659077e68c85d3a05d91fc OP_EQUAL
address
3HJjfJTo8eeqMgnYcRHpMBrKCQDdcSZgmU
transaction
21a7fb39595d5d6f5988c4b357988b74f55589f558c7bdb46ca740ea7d68a155
spent
true